Output d58385e9bfb1cf2bafc150e8dd35b2f9ca57344451f8b001706e1b6439a40bd2:0

value
60895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63c31ea7fb789522fb6b3bb8930409411738ea03 OP_EQUAL
address
3AnWZh9EA16hpsqZuewXghQeGP1o93N4Qn
transaction
d58385e9bfb1cf2bafc150e8dd35b2f9ca57344451f8b001706e1b6439a40bd2
confirmations
567522
spent
true